Ontario SPCA addresses community concerns regarding suspended Toronto Humane Society allegedly conducting investigations

Toronto, ON (June 22, 2009) - The Ontario SPCA would like to take this opportunity to acknowledge and address community concerns regarding the Toronto Humane Society allegedly conducting animal cruelty investigations in Toronto while their status as an affiliate member is currently suspended. The Toronto Humane Society has no more right or authority than a private citizen to intervene on behalf of animals in distress. The Toronto Humane Society's actions are not performed under the authority of the Ontario SPCA Act. Additionally, actions taken by the Toronto Humane Society, as private citizens acting as investigators, circumvents an animal owner’s ability to appeal to the Animal Care Review Board, an independent body of the Ministry of Community Safely and Correctional Services that ensures that activities of Ontario SPCA agents and inspectors are appropriate and transparent.

About the Ontario SPCA

The Ontario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(Ontario SPCA): Protecting animals since 1873, the Ontario SPCA is a registered charity comprised of over 50 Communities relying primarily on donations to fund animal protection, care and rehabilitation; advocacy; and humane education. The Ontario SPCA Act mandates the Society to enforce animal cruelty laws and provides Society investigators with police powers to do so - making the Ontario SPCA unique among animal welfare organizations in the province. The Ontario SPCA is a member of the Canadian Federation of Humane Societies, the World Society for the Protection of Animals, and is affiliated with the Royal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als.
